Momentum Children’s Charity supports families across London, Surrey, and Sussex whose children are facing cancer or a life-challenging condition. We work in partnership with local hospitals to provide tailored support, therapy services, and respite breaks to help families cope during the most difficult times.

As a Community Champion, you will be a passionate advocate for Momentum Children’s Charity in your local area. You’ll raise awareness, inspire others to get involved, and play a vital role in helping us build a growing network of community-led fundraising support. You’ll take ownership of local engagement and help drive income generation, working alongside a values-led charity team that is committed to making a real difference.

This is a brilliant opportunity to gain experience in charity promotion and community organising, with access to training, support, and the chance to grow your skills in a purposeful and flexible role.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Social Media Advocacy: Share Momentum’s stories, campaigns, events and even job roles on your personal social media platforms.
  • Community Group Engagement: Help grow a network of supporters by encouraging the formation of a self-led Community      Fundraising Group in your area. Taking the lead on organising and delivering at least two events (typically markets or fairs) per year.
  • Collection Tin Coordination: Place and monitor collection tins in local shops and venues, and collect donations (access to a car or   ability to travel locally preferred).
  • Leafleting and Posters: Distribute leaflets and put up posters in local shops, schools, libraries, and community spaces.

  • Event Promotion: Help promote local fundraising events and initiatives, encouraging friends, family, and neighbours to take part.

  • Local Networking: Build relationships with local businesses, schools, and groups who may want to support the charity, and feeding leads back to the relevant teams at Momentum.

  • Feedback and Ideas: Share insights from your community with the team to help shape engagement strategy.

What skills do I need?

  • A strong connection to your local community

    Friendly, proactive, and enthusiastic about making a difference

  • Good communication skills

  • Comfortable using WhatsApp and community messaging platforms

  • Reliable and able to work independently

  • Willing and able to travel locally to attend events or drop off materials

  • Access to a car for travel to local events
